For this set of Ushio Noa cosplay, in order to achieve the ideal level of accuracy, I put a lot of effort into preparing the costume and props beforehand. Regarding the white hair cosplay wig, I paid special attention to the layering of the bangs, trimming them thin and wispy to bring out that unique airy feel of anime, while pairing them with the precise positioning of the geometric hair accessory on the side to ensure it wouldn't slip off during large movements. As for the light blue contact lenses, I chose a pair with high transparency to make my gaze look softer under the light, fitting the character's gentle yet rational nature.
The main outfit consists of an oversized white and blue coat. In terms of fabric selection, I deliberately avoided stiff uniform materials and instead used a blended fabric with good drape and breathability, so that the lake-blue ribbons at the cuffs could form an elegant curve when draping naturally. The coat features numerous details, such as the dark contrast lining at the collar, the eye-catching red square pattern on the sleeve, and the sharp geometric tailoring on both sides of the lapel. Together, these design elements construct the character's futuristic and airy feel. The lake-blue tie underneath becomes the bright visual focal point against the dominant white tone.
The lower half consists of a pure white pleated miniskirt with neat folds, paired with matte black tights to form a striking contrast. The visual clash between this black tights outfit and white boots brings out a sharp, stylish aesthetic within this techwear-inspired design. The heels of the white chunky shoes feature the same blue as the coat's ribbons, creating a top-to-bottom color echo that elevates the completeness of the entire look.
As for props, the sci-fi handgun prop I got has a great texture; the surface paint is smooth and even, and the mechanical grooves on the gun body are finely detailed. Although the prop has some weight, holding it at the waist as a support or letting it hang naturally during shooting actually made my poses look more natural and less stiff. The all-white background on the day of the shoot was quite a challenge for lighting setup. Hard light easily leaves strong shadows on the face, while purely soft light makes white clothes blend into the white background. After discussing with the photographer, we used side-backlighting combined with frontal fill light. This created a gentle glow along the edges of my hair while keeping facial shadows clean, naturally highlighting facial contours. During the shoot, I tried several different poses: for instance, turning slightly sideways and resting my chin on my hand while standing showed off both upper-body layering and lower-body leg lines, whereas leaning forward into the camera reinforced an expression of focused concentration.
Stepping in front of the lens and immersing myself in the character's mindset made me adjust my posture instinctively. Placing my weight slightly on the back foot and straightening my spine instantly changed my presence; this subtle physical control recreated the dignified demeanor unique to the character.
